About the Event

Action Canada’s 16 Fellows will gather again in cosmopolitan Montreal! There, they’ll attend Resetting the Table, Food Secure Canada’s 10th Assembly. Montreal is a major food transformation hub for Canada especially in the dairy and meat industries as well as a the home of an unparalleled foodie scene fed by the city’s rich diversity. It’s the third study tour of the 10-month program and will provide opportunities to meet many of the experts that will inform the three research projects that are taking shape.

The agenda includes:

  • Peer coaching sessions with Executive Coach Suzanne Nault
  • Achieving policy impact with Morris Rosenberg
  • Writing awesome op-eds with Kate Heartfield
  • An introduction to Quebec with mentor, alum and recent Marcel Côté award recipient Guillaume Lavoie
  • And much more

Throughout the week, the Task Forces will gather facts and information for the reports and recommendations they’ll present at the final conference in Ottawa next March.
